According to Masserang, most of the fundamental issues with foundations and crawl spaces in North Carolina can be attributed to soil conditions. As foundations are more often than not built atop concrete that has been poured directly into the underlying soil, any issues with the soil can cause problems for the foundation. In Charlotte and the rest of the Piedmont area in general, the soil is heavily saturated with clay.

Clay is classified as an ‘expansive soil.’ This means that when it is dry, it contracts and is resistant to penetration by water, a soil condition known as being hydrophobic, or resisting water. This can happen in drought conditions. When the soil contracts, it can remove support from the very foundation of a property. Alternatively, when clay does absorb water, it can expand up to 10% of its volume. This expansion can exert tremendous pressure on the foundation, causing the structure to heave and bow.

Indications of issues with a foundation can also be seen in other areas. Sinking or sloping floors and gaps between floors, walls and ceiling are also key signs of foundation issues, as are walls bowing inward. All of these issues are caused by soil either contracting or expanding due to the presence or the lack of water — which should also highlight why proper water drainage around a property is very important.
